Problems with Galaxy S2

Anonymous
Not applicable

FIRSTLY My phone was new November 2012 but not only is it laden with apps I'll never use, the majority is Irish apps (newspapers and the such-like). I live in the East Midlands! Even more unexpected is that  on 'page 2' (if you see what I mean) I have VODAFONE apps 'appselect', 'music shop', 'my web' and 'updates'!!!!!!!! I don't understand how this can be?

I took on a new number when I had the phone from o2 (i was previously with Vodafone) and am getting the odd text and message for what must have been the previous number-holder.

SECONDLY I am having issues with the screen going blank once a call is made so that if it rings to voicemail I cannot access any of the buttons to end the call and it won't respond to the 'big button' either. Is this a known problem?

Your phone has Irish Vodafone firmware on it !!!

A factory reset will do you no good whatsoever. If this came from O2 in the UK, take it back and ask for a genuine UK O2 phone. If it came from somewhere else you can still reflash with UK firmware but you'll have to do it yourself with a programme called Odin.
